5. Typeform Best for Engaging, Conversational Surveys

Source: Typeform

Typeform has left a lasting impression on me as one of the best survey software options available. Its innovative approach to survey design and its array of features make it an exceptional choice for businesses seeking engaging and insightful surveys.

What truly sets Typeform apart is its ability to create conversational and interactive surveys. By employing a user-friendly interface and presenting questions one at a time, Typeform keeps respondents engaged throughout the survey process.

This approach leads to higher completion rates and more accurate data. Plus, its robust reporting and analytics tools provide valuable insights that drive data-based decision-making.

Besides, Typeform offers numerous features, such as seamless embedding options, easy integration with various apps, streamlined workflow, and more, that make it an excellent tool for collecting data.

What you’ll like:

  • AI-powered surveys that require minimal inputs and manual handling
  • Extensive question types and logical conditions for tailored and insightful surveys
  • Seamless integrations with 100+ popular apps for enhanced functionality and data integration
  • Built-in analytics dashboard and visually appealing reports for convenient data analysis
  • Mobile-friendly platform with advanced security measures and automation capabilities for a seamless experience
  • Supports multiple ways of survey sharing, whether by sending surveys by email, landing page, or a survey link to anyone interested

What you may not like:

  • Glitches while submitting reports are known to occur at times
  • The one-question-at-a-time setup can be a limiting factor in situations where cluster questions are required

Pricing:

Paid plans start at $25/month.

7. FastFieldBest for Mobile-Friendly Survey Forms

Source: FastField

FastField is a great survey data collection software solution that streamlines workflows and saves time by enabling the creation of fully customizable mobile forms.

Its intuitive mobile applications make it easier to collect rich data sets that can be easily analyzed for insights and trends.

FastField’s best use case is its mobile-friendly survey forms feature that allows users to build custom digital forms that are tailored to their specific data collection needs.

Users can benefit from this feature by improving their response rates and gathering data on the go, all while reducing data entry errors and saving valuable time.

Other features that make FastField a great survey data collection software include its extreme flexibility, robust online form builder, offline data capture, automated workflow, and robust integrations.

What you’ll like:

  • Mobile-friendly forms app compatible with both iOS and Android devices
  • Flexible digital form builder without any prior technical knowledge required
  • Real-time data visualization with built-in dashboards
  • Enterprise-grade mobile forms software with offline data capture
  • Fully customizable form creation including image capture with annotations and drawings
  • Automation of form dispatch and report/data delivery based on specific business rules and workflow

What you may not like:

  • Integrations are often glitch, resulting in disrupted workflow
  • Customer service needs to be more proactive in resolving complicated issues

Pricing:

Starts at $25/month

9. PollfishBest for AI-Assisted Survey Creation

Source: Pollfish

Pollfish is an exceptional survey data collection software that I personally endorse. With its mobile-first approach and real-time responses from 250 million real consumers worldwide, Pollfish offers a comprehensive end-to-end solution, revolutionizing market research.

Its best use case lies in AI-assisted survey creation, where you can simply input your survey goal and let the AI generate a questionnaire that specifically addresses your research needs.

The tool sports an intuitive, user-friendly platform and has speedy results visible on the real-time dashboard and dynamic sampling with random device engagement.

It empowers non-technical users with cutting-edge technology, eliminates survey bias, and ensures high-quality data.

What you’ll like:

  • AI-assisted survey creation where you simply type your survey goal and let AI create a questionnaire specifically tailored to your research needs
  • Survey responses can be viewed in real-time on the Pollfish dashboard
  • Dynamic sampling and random device engagement to let you engage with respondents organically, reducing survey panel bias
  • Robust quality checks eliminate fraudulent responses and ensure data aligns with targeting criteria
  • User-friendly platform and intuitive survey creation with a simple, easy-to-navigate UI

What you may not like:

  • Sometimes does not represent correct visual representation of data the data collected from survey participants
  • Frequency of use is restricted on free subscription

Pricing:

Starts at $95/month

Evaluation Criteria 

The evaluation of products or tools chosen for this article follows an unbiased, systematic approach that ensures a fair, insightful, and well-rounded review. This method employs six key factors:

  1. User Reviews / Ratings: Direct experiences from users, including ratings and feedback from reputable sites, provide a ground-level perspective. This feedback is critical in understanding overall satisfaction and potential problems.
  2. Essential Features & Functionality: The value of a product is ascertained by its core features and overall functionality. Through an in-depth exploration of these aspects, the practical usefulness and effectiveness of the tools are carefully evaluated.
  3. Ease of Use: The user-friendliness of a product or service is assessed, focusing on the design, interface, and navigation. This ensures a positive experience for users of all levels of expertise.
  4. Customer Support: The quality of customer support is examined, taking into account its efficiency and how well it supports users in different phases – setting up, addressing concerns, and resolving operational issues.
  5. Value for Money: Value for money is evaluated by comparing the quality, performance, and features. The goal is to help the reader understand whether they would be getting their money’s worth. 
  6. Personal Experience / Experts’ Opinions: This part of the evaluation criteria draws insightful observations from the personal experience of the writer and the opinions of industry experts.
